Output e60e9081eecee1a1015953ff92bedc88096e93ad598306ef996469c73bf3c18e:1

value
939856
script pubkey
OP_0 OP_PUSHBYTES_20 8d89e71140672cb41cd8ec8bcb3c2fcaf0f73947
address
bc1q3ky7wy2qvuktg8xcaj9uk0p0etc0ww28nhdrsw
transaction
e60e9081eecee1a1015953ff92bedc88096e93ad598306ef996469c73bf3c18e
confirmations
278848
spent
true